Taylor-Listug, Inc., commonly known as Taylor Guitars, is a renowned American manufacturer headquartered in El Cajon, California. Founded in 1974, the company has established itself as a leader in the acoustic guitar industry, celebrated for its innovative designs and commitment to quality craftsmanship. Taylor Guitars offers a diverse range of products, including premium acoustic guitars, electric guitars, and accessories, distinguished by their unique tonal qualities and sustainable sourcing practices. The company has achieved significant milestones, such as pioneering the use of computer-aided design in guitar making and promoting environmentally responsible wood sourcing. With a strong market position, Taylor Guitars is recognised globally for its exceptional instruments, catering to musicians of all levels. Their dedication to innovation and sustainability continues to set them apart in the competitive landscape of musical instrument manufacturing.
